HomeLife Magazine Culture Column

You’ve probably heard the tune and if you’re like me, you only really know one line: “It’s the end of the world as we know it.” I am unaware of the message of the entire song, but I do know that when I look out at the landscape of our culture I can begin to think, it’s the end of the world as we know it. If we set our gaze on the world we will surely be discouraged. But when we look through the lens of the Bible we can begin to understand, if even slightly, why things are this way. We can begin to develop a biblical worldview regarding culture and society.

In 2014 Lifeway’s HomeLife Magazine will begin featuring a culture column written by me. The short column will focus on the issues and topics that face our culture today such as tragedies and our response, racial reconciliation, abortion, sex, marriage, friendship and more. I’m praying that the column would encourage the HomeLife readers and spark new conversations…
